The Ackers Trust
Also known as: The Ackers
CONSERVES 75 ACRE SITE AT SMALL HEATH, IN BIRMINGHAM. PROVIDES ENVIRONMENTAL VOLUNTEERING OPPORTUNITIES& EDUCATION. SITE IS MANAGED AS A PUBLIC AMENITY OFFERING WALKS, CYCLING, PICNIC & RECREATIONAL AREAS ETC. FREE USE OF PITCHES AND MUGA FOR COMMUNITYSITE ALSO OFFERS OUTDOOR ADVENTURE ACTIVITIES WHICH ARE MANAGED BY ACKERS ADVENTURE.

When was The Ackers Trust registered as a charity?
The Ackers Trust was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 27 September 1983 as charity number 511343. It has been registered for 43 years.
Who runs The Ackers Trust?
The Ackers Trust is governed by a board of 4 trustees.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.
Where does The Ackers Trust operate?
The Ackers Trust operates in Birmingham City, as recorded in its Charity Commission filing.
Is The Ackers Trust a registered charity?
Yes — The Ackers Trust is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 511343.
